Ariel bowl - I almost recognise it.
« on: March 08, 2009, 06:24:16 PM »
Thickwalled crystal bowl height 7,5 diameter 11 (2"and 4.1/4" respectively) with air inclusions. The finish is impeccable, but the maker carelessly forgot to sign it.  The pattern seems to be dots, dashes, colons and semicolons - which leaves me with a question mark. Anyone seen this before?
